Transaction 325938322d6061b698adcf40b5e027bf1184b0ba3934b1485e657d6a06d218f6
1 Input
1 Output
-
325938322d6061b698adcf40b5e027bf1184b0ba3934b1485e657d6a06d218f6:0
- value
- 609600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 91fb62761a1594f24b2b5daf4f8b1399c2f5f648 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EJt8Kq6PT13LcBee88bBDpxBExMChy5zB